135. To ask the Minister for Education and Skills the estimated full year cost of continuing the restoration of postgraduate grants with the restoration of the partial band rate;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[44240/18]

Photo of Joe McHughJoe McHugh (Donegal, Fine Gael)
Link to this: Individually | In context | Oireachtas source

As the Deputy will be aware, additional funding of €7m was secured in Budgets 2017 and 2018 to facilitate the reinstatement of full maintenance grants from September 2017, for the most disadvantaged postgraduate students. This benefitted circa 1,000 postgraduate students who met the eligibility criteria for the special rate of maintenance grant for the academic year 2017/18 and reversed the budgetary cut that was imposed on this cohort of students in 2012.

If postgraduate supports and numbers were returned to the pre-2012 level, it is estimated that additional funding of €44.1m would be required on top of the additional €7m secured in recent budgets.
